MITRE is different from most technology companies. We are a not-for-profit corporation chartered to work for the public interest, with no commercial conflicts to influence what we do. The R&D centers we operate for the government create lasting impact in fields as diverse as cybersecurity, healthcare, aviation, defense, and enterprise transformation. In MITRE's Air & Space Forces Center, our mission is to solve U.S. Air Force and U.S. Space Force challenges through operational understanding, technical expertise, and cross-enterprise connectivity. It is all about taking on the problems and challenges our Air & Space Force sponsors bring to us and using our unique set of capabilities at MITRE to deliberately solve them. Our vision is to enable air and space superiority through data, knowledge, and decision-making. We aim to achieve dynamic and effective command and control (C2), ensuring relevant capabilities are available whenever and wherever needed. The Air & Space Forces Center (A&SFC) Chief Engineer (CE) is a deep technical leader with a proven track record of developing joint-program strategies and contributing across this lifecycle to produce innovative and high-impact solutions to a broad range of pacing mission challenges.
The A&SFC CE works in partnership with the A&SFC Vice President, Managing Directors, and the Division Chief Engineers to shape the right work that contributes to achieving the priority objectives of Center/Sector/Corporate strategies. The A&SFC CE ensures the work is done right by promoting practices to assess and continually improve technical quality in partnership with Chief Engineers across the Center and MITRE. The Center CE collaborates with counterparts across MITRE to promote, develop, and leverage MITRE platforms and technical capabilities. Given the span and complexity of the Department of Air Force mission and sponsor space, it is particularly important for the Center CE to be a catalyst for cross-cutting integration and innovation working in close partnership with the MNS Cross-Cutting Priority Outcome leads and with the MITRE Innovation program IALs to bring the best solutions and value for sponsors.
